When Chris Messina walked the red carpet at last night’s Golden Globes, fans were quick to notice his new bleach blonde hair (and Twitter was there for it).

https://twitter.com/blackmon/status/1082075873510154240

However, fans speculate that Messina—who attended the Globes as part of the Sharp Objects cast—might have blonde locks due to his role as super-villain Victor Zsasz in DC’s Birds of Prey (and the Fantabulous Emancipation of One Harley Quinn). While Zsasz often appears in the comics with a shaved head, he also appears with blonde hair similar to Messina’s—and people noticed.

Zsasz appears in the DC comics as a serial killer who adds a tally mark to his body for each of his kills. In Birds of Prey, he will likely work closely with Black Mask (Ewan McGregor) as they battle multiple female superheroes.

Birds of Prey (and the Fantabulous Emancipation of One Harley Quinn) will debut on Feb. 7, 2020.
